摘要
A porous surface is synthesized in sintered composite material using electron beams or lasers. The technique can be used for producing self lubricating bearing materials. The composite comprises 90 weight percent copper, 8 weight percent tin and 2 weight percent graphite, pressed at pressures up to 590 MPa and sintered 800 DEG C. The surface of the specimen was subjected to electron beam melting using an oscillated beam of focused electrons. Electron beam surface melting not only provide a dense substrate and a surface layer of required porosity, it also promises refined microstructural features of the surface and enhanced chemical uniformity due to rapid solidification of the melted layer.
